22.2  Oscillator 
Clock pulses can be supplied by connecting a crystal resonator, or by input of an external clock. 
22.2.1  Connecting a Crystal Resonator 
A crystal resonator can be connected as shown in the example in figure 22.2. Select the damping 
resistance R
d
 according to table 22.1. When a crystal resonator is used, the range of its frequencies 
is from 8 to 20 MHz. 
Figure 22.3 shows the equivalent circuit of the crystal resonator. Use a crystal resonator that has 
the characteristics shown in table 22.2.
